Nov 20, 2019nbsp018332in the sulfate process, the size of the titanium dioxide particles is not controlled by grinding, but is determined during the hydrolysisprecipitation and the calcination steps. formation of a useful pigment requires calcination, usually in a rotary oven at around 900c over a period of hours.

Formation of titanium sponge took place at the metal production plant of tsp through kroll process. the raw materials used are metal grade ticl 4 and the high purity magnesium mg metal. the processes involves reduction of ticl 4 with mg and pyro-vacuum distillation to tap out the mgcl 2 produced as by product during the process.
